Whilst playing our monthly medal Saturday, I hit my tee shot which may or may not have cleared the trees. I was convinced it had so did not play a provisional ball. When we got to the place I thought the ball was it was not there. After a minute or two looking I decided I had better return to the tee and play a provisional ball. I did not declare my first ball lost I just didn't want to hold up play.I went back to the tee and had to let the group behind play through. I hit my second ball then when I went up the fairway there was my original ball. I did not hit the provisional ball and hit my original ball to the green. I found out today that I have been disqualified for playing the wrong ball and signing for the wrong score. Is this correct?
 
Once you leave the tee and look for the ball, if you go back to replay, the second ball is not a provisional but the ball in play, you have played 3 and the first tee shot is lost and can't be found and put back in play. You may not have declared the ball lost but in going back to hit another, it became lost under the rules.
